Strategic Considerations

This section outlines essential considerations for addressing imbalances arising from unfavorable interactions between chance-based mechanics and inherently flawed character attributes.

Tip 1: Analyze Underlying Mechanics: Thoroughly examine the specific rules and algorithms governing both the probabilistic elements and the attributes contributing to the imbalance. A detailed understanding of these mechanics is fundamental to identifying the root cause of the problem.

Tip 2: Quantify the Impact: Employ statistical analysis or simulations to quantify the extent to which the chance-based mechanic amplifies the inherent flaw. This will provide concrete data for evaluating the severity of the issue and prioritizing solutions.

Tip 3: Adjust Probabilistic Parameters: Modify the probability distributions of the chance-based element to mitigate its negative impact. This may involve reducing the frequency of unfavorable outcomes or introducing mitigating factors.

Tip 4: Rebalance Attributes: Reassess and adjust the attributes of the character or element exhibiting the inherent flaw. This may involve enhancing strengths to compensate for weaknesses or directly addressing the source of the imbalance.

Tip 5: Introduce Compensatory Mechanics: Implement mechanics that provide opportunities to counteract the negative effects of the chance-based element. This could involve introducing abilities or strategies that mitigate the impact of unfavorable outcomes.

Tip 6: Implement Safeguards: Incorporate safeguards to prevent extreme or unintended consequences. This may involve setting upper or lower limits on the impact of the chance-based element or introducing fail-safe mechanisms.

Tip 7: Conduct Thorough Testing: Rigorously test any proposed solutions across a wide range of scenarios to ensure their effectiveness and identify any unintended side effects. This should involve both automated testing and human playtesting.

Effective management of these considerations leads to a more balanced and engaging experience by reducing the impact of undesirable interactions.
